Why South Korea is the Global Leader in Stomach Cancer Treatment?
South Korea boasts the highest gastric cancer survival rates in the world. Combining unparalleled surgical expertise, cutting-edge robotic technology, and highly specialized oncology centers, the country offers a standard of care that consistently outperforms Western benchmarks for stomach cancer.
World-Leading Survival Rates
Due to comprehensive national screening programs, South Korean surgeons perform a staggering volume of gastric surgeries annually. This unmatched clinical experience translates directly into the world's highest five-year survival rates for stomach cancer, far exceeding statistics found in the US or Europe.
Pioneering Robotic & Minimally Invasive Surgery
Korean oncology centers are global pioneers in minimally invasive laparoscopic and robotic-assisted gastrectomies. These advanced techniques ensure precise tumor removal and meticulous lymph node dissection while minimizing trauma, resulting in significantly faster recovery times and preserved quality of life.
Multidisciplinary Oncology Boards
Cancer care in South Korea is highly collaborative. Every patient benefits from a Multidisciplinary Team (MDT) approach, where specialized surgeons, medical oncologists, radiologists, and pathologists convene to design a highly personalized, targeted treatment strategy tailored to your specific tumor profile.
Rapid Diagnostics and Execution
Time is critical in cancer treatment. South Korean medical infrastructure is designed for high efficiency, meaning international patients undergo advanced staging (like PET-CT and endoscopic ultrasounds) and move directly into surgical or oncological treatment within days, avoiding the stressful delays common in Western healthcare systems.

Advanced Stomach Cancer Procedures in South Korea
Korean oncologists specialize in a spectrum of treatments, from organ-preserving endoscopic methods for early-stage cancers to highly complex robotic surgeries for advanced tumors.
Endoscopic Submucosal Dissection (ESD)
$6,000 – $9,500A highly refined technique utilized for very early-stage stomach cancer. Using a specialized endoscope, Korean experts peel the cancerous lesion directly from the stomach lining without any external incisions, preserving the entire stomach and allowing for rapid recovery.
Save $19,000+ vs. US prices
Laparoscopic Gastrectomy
$14,000 – $20,000The standard of care in Korea for operable gastric tumors. Instead of large open incisions, surgeons use a camera and long instruments inserted through tiny keyholes to remove part or all of the stomach, drastically reducing post-operative pain and hospital stay duration.
Save $36,000+ vs. US prices
Robotic-Assisted Gastrectomy
$22,000 – $28,500Utilizing advanced da Vinci surgical systems, Korean surgeons achieve unmatched precision. The 3D magnification and wristed instruments allow for perfect lymph node clearance around vital blood vessels, reducing recurrence risks in complex cancer cases.
Save $58,000+ vs. US prices
Targeted Therapy & Immunotherapy
$2,500 – $5,000 (Per Cycle)For advanced or metastatic stomach cancers, Korean hospitals deploy the latest genomic sequencing to match your tumor with highly specific targeted drugs or immunotherapies, often providing access to advanced medications before they are widely available elsewhere.

Your Stomach Cancer Treatment Journey in South Korea
Knowing what to expect can alleviate the anxiety of traveling for critical care. Here is the typical clinical timeline for international gastric cancer patients.
Step 1: Virtual Case Review
Submit your biopsy reports, endoscopy results, and CT/PET scans via PlacidWay. A dedicated Korean multidisciplinary oncology team will analyze your records to determine if you are a candidate for surgery, ESD, or initial chemotherapy, providing a preliminary treatment plan.
Step 2: Arrival & Rapid Diagnostic Staging
Upon arrival at the hospital's international clinic, you will immediately undergo advanced pre-operative staging. This typically includes a high-definition endoscopic ultrasound and advanced 3D imaging to map the exact depth and spread of the stomach tumor.
Step 3: Tumor Board Consultation
Before any procedure, you and your family will meet with your primary surgeon, accompanied by a medical interpreter. The finalized surgical strategy (laparoscopic vs. robotic) and the extent of the gastrectomy are explained in detail, answering all your concerns.
Step 4: Surgical Intervention & Hospitalization
The procedure is performed in state-of-the-art operating theaters. Following surgery, you will spend 5 to 10 days in a specialized surgical ward. Korean hospitals provide intensive post-op care, carefully monitoring your transition from IV nutrition back to oral intake.
Step 5: Discharge and Follow-up Planning
Once you are stable and eating a specialized diet, you will be discharged to a nearby hotel for outpatient recovery. Before returning to your home country, the oncology team will provide comprehensive follow-up guidelines and coordinate with your local oncologist for any required chemotherapy.
